Common use of No Material Defaults Clause in Contracts

No Material Defaults. Other than payments due but not yet 30 days or more delinquent, there is (A) no material default, breach, violation or event of acceleration existing under the related Mortgage Note, the related Mortgage or other loan documents relating to such Mortgage Loan, and (B), to the knowledge of the Seller, no event which, with the passage of time or with notice and the expiration of any grace or cure period, would constitute a material default, breach, violation or event of acceleration under any of such documents; provided, however, that this representation and warranty does not cover any default, breach, violation or event of acceleration (A) that specifically pertains to or arises out of the subject matter otherwise covered by any other representation and warranty made by the Seller in this Exhibit B or (B) with respect to which the Seller has no actual knowledge. The Seller has not waived, in writing or with knowledge, any material default, breach, violation or event of acceleration under any of such documents. Under the terms of such Mortgage Loan, no person or party other than the mortgagee or its servicing agent may declare an event of default or accelerate the related indebtedness under such Mortgage Loan.
